Transaction 2ecfaf28ffce8fd134695ce99b6cad6326166fb59c976ff03f1763e3c143c47a

1 Input
1 Outputs
  • 2ecfaf28ffce8fd134695ce99b6cad6326166fb59c976ff03f1763e3c143c47a:0
  • value  346362930
    address  bc1qw06z88hw8waat3ye7wepcn8m9mrzzc5shg97df